sql >> Databáze >  >> RDS >> Oracle

Chyba Oracle:[:into:neznámý operátor

Proměnná mSQLCode v řádku if [ $mSQLCode -ne 0 ] musí být v uvozovkách, což vypadá následovně:if [ "$mSQLCode" -ne 0 ] .

Důvodem je, že mSQLCode je výsledkem dotazu Oracle, který zahrnuje více řádků kódu (insert into ... ). Proměnné musí být v uvozovkách, což znamená, že je třeba vzít v úvahu více řádků v dotazu.




  1. SQL Server azbuka psaní '?????'

  2. Co je špatného na mém CASE?

  3. Aktualizace více hodnot v MySQL

  4. Proč \dt PostgreSQL zobrazuje pouze veřejné tabulky schémat?